Daylight Saving Time: Origins, Impacts, and Future Perspectives

Daylight Saving Time (DST) has been a subject of debate and discussion for over a century. Its primary aim is to make better use of daylight during the longer days of summer, but its implementation and effects have varied across different regions and eras.

Origins and Objectives of Daylight Saving Time

The concept of adjusting clocks to make better use of daylight has ancient roots. The Romans, for instance, used water clocks that varied in length depending on the time of year, effectively accounting for the changing daylight hours. However, the modern idea of DST was first proposed in 1784 by Benjamin Franklin. In a satirical letter to the Journal de Paris, Franklin suggested that Parisians could economize on candles by waking up earlier to utilize morning sunlight. This proposal was more of a humorous observation than a serious policy suggestion. (en.wikipedia.org)

The first practical implementation of DST occurred in 1908 in Port Arthur, Ontario, Canada (now Thunder Bay). Residents advanced their clocks by one hour to extend evening daylight, setting a precedent for future adoption. (timeanddate.com)

During World War I, Germany and Austria-Hungary adopted DST on April 30, 1916, to conserve fuel by reducing the need for artificial lighting. The United Kingdom, along with its allies and many European neutrals, soon followed suit. The United States implemented DST in 1918 through the Standard Time Act, which established time zones and set summer DST to begin on March 31, 1918, reverting on October 27. (en.wikipedia.org)

The primary objective of DST has been to make better use of daylight during the longer days of summer, thereby conserving energy and providing more daylight hours for outdoor activities. Proponents argue that it leads to energy savings, increased economic activity, and more opportunities for leisure and exercise.

Impact on Biological Rhythms and Health

The transition into and out of DST has been shown to disrupt human circadian rhythms, negatively affecting health. Studies have observed an increase in heart attacks and traffic accidents following the shift into DST. A 2017 study estimated that the transition into DST caused over 30 deaths at a social cost of $275 million annually, primarily due to increased sleep deprivation. (en.wikipedia.org)

Additionally, research indicates that the biannual clock changes can lead to a temporary decrease in life satisfaction and an increase in the feeling of being rushed for time. The spring transition into DST, in particular, has been associated with a decrease in leisure time and a reduction in overall well-being. (en.wikipedia.org)

Health experts have called for the elimination of DST to prevent these adverse health effects. A recent study suggests that abandoning DST and adopting permanent standard time could prevent over 300,000 strokes and more than 2 million obesity cases annually in the U.S. (livescience.com)

Economic and Energy Implications

The initial rationale for DST was to conserve energy by reducing the need for artificial lighting. However, studies have shown that the actual energy savings are minimal. For instance, a 2008 study by the U.S. Department of Energy reported nationwide electricity savings of only 0.03% for the year 2007. (en.wikipedia.org)

Economically, the impact of DST is mixed. While some sectors, such as retail and tourism, may benefit from increased evening daylight, other industries, like agriculture, have historically opposed DST. Farmers argue that the time change disrupts their schedules, as they have less time in the morning to get their products to market. (en.wikipedia.org)

Effects on Daily Activities and Lifestyle

The shift into DST can lead to changes in daily routines. People may find it challenging to adjust their sleep patterns, leading to temporary sleep deprivation and decreased productivity. The change can also affect social activities, with some individuals experiencing a decrease in leisure time following the transition. (en.wikipedia.org)

In the United States, the Senate passed the Sunshine Protection Act in 2022, aiming to make DST permanent. However, the bill did not become law, as it was not approved by the House of Representatives. (time.com)

Implications for Children and Education

The time change can have significant effects on children, particularly in the school setting. Disruptions in sleep patterns can lead to decreased alertness and performance in school. Studies have shown that the transition into DST is associated with an increase in traffic accidents, which can pose risks to children commuting to school. (en.wikipedia.org)

Controversies and Current Debates in Switzerland

In Switzerland, the debate over DST has been ongoing. The European Union has considered abolishing the biannual clock changes, with the European Parliament voting to scrap DST from 2021. However, as of 2025, the change has not been implemented, and discussions continue regarding the potential benefits and drawbacks of permanent DST or standard time. (en.wikipedia.org)

Possible Alternatives to Time Changes

Alternatives to the current system include adopting permanent standard time or permanent DST. Proponents of permanent standard time argue that it would reduce health risks associated with time changes and provide more consistent sleep patterns. On the other hand, supporters of permanent DST believe it would offer more evening daylight, benefiting various sectors of the economy. (en.wikipedia.org)

How to Adapt to the Time Change

To minimize the negative effects of the time change, experts recommend gradually adjusting sleep schedules before the transition, maintaining a consistent sleep routine, and ensuring exposure to natural light during the day. These strategies can help mitigate the impact of the time change on health and daily activities. (en.wikipedia.org)
